CALGARY, AB (October 26, 2009) - Len Hong, President and CEO of the Canadian Centre for Occupational Health and Safety (CCOHS) will be presenting Solutions for Improving Mental Health In Workplaces at the 8th Annual Alberta Health & Safety Conference and Trade Fair , in Calgary, Alberta, on Wednesday, October 28.

An effective, national mental health strategy must integrate this important issue within Canadian workplaces. Hong’s presentation will highlight a number of ideas and solutions for improving workplace mental health from international and Canadian experiences.
